Does the remote comm radio require the connection of the panel control head? I would like to install the radio and control it through either EFIS without the panel control head.

It does require a connection to the control head but it wouldn't need to be mounted on the panel. I have some customers that have mounted them for rear seat control, or in door panels.

It connects via the SV Network to the 5400.
I don't know what the SV network is? Is that an RS232 connection to an available port on the AF-5400? Can I put it on the MFD (since I have no available ports on my PFD)?
The AF-5000 R7 EFIS Expansion harness has the connections for the SV-Network
